Joyce Isabel (Warner) Hayes, age 82, of Dixon, was born on April 25, 1943, a daughter of Floyd Melvin and Fern Dixie (Bull) Warner and passed from this life on Tuesday morning, July 1, 2025, in the Dixon Nursing and Rehab Center, Dixon. Joyce had drove a school bus for Vienna schools for five years and later retired from Wal-Mart after several years of working in loss prevention. She loved to bake, and some of the families favorites were her pies, breads and cinnamon rolls. In her spare time she enjoyed quilting and listening to her grandson, Timmy playing music and in her younger years, she was an avid deer and squirrel hunter and enjoyed fishing and playing cards with her family. Those left to mourn the passing of Joyce include: her daughter, Lisa Dee James of Vienna; her grandson, Timothy Read James of Troy, Missouri; her sister, Carol Sue "Susie" Nelson of Loveland, Colorado as well as numerous nephews, nieces, cousins and other relatives and friends. Joyce was preceded in death by her father, Floyd on February 21, 1996; her mother, Fern on November 20, 1999; five brothers, Kenneth Warner on May 21, 1942 at the age of 6 months; Terry Allen Warner on February 13, 1983; Gary David Warner on March 28, 2008; Francis Michael "Mike" Warner on March 7, 2010 and Larry Gene Warner on April 21, 2010. In keeping with Joyce's wishes, cremation was elected under the direction of the Martin-Kloeppel Funeral Home and Cremation Services, Dixon. Inurnment will be in the Kenner Cemetery near Dixon and a later date and time.
